The TC7WH157FU(TE12L) is a CMOS logic IC that functions as a 2-input multiplexer. It selects one of the two input signals based on the select (/S) input and routes it to the output (Y). The internal circuitry utilizes complementary metal-oxide-semiconductor (CMOS) technology, which allows for high-speed operation and low power consumption.
